Output a669fda63ae331faa98b7b8bbe220bfa01d9eba1d0dfbe2d0a4bb97190474369:0

value
12906
script pubkey
OP_0 OP_PUSHBYTES_20 b254a934421015102f25d40d2481c212da82ba6f
address
bc1qkf22jdzzzq23qte96sxjfqwzztdg9wn0hr63d2
transaction
a669fda63ae331faa98b7b8bbe220bfa01d9eba1d0dfbe2d0a4bb97190474369
confirmations
98639
spent
true